  The pro-Russian Party of Socialists of the Republic of Moldova (PSRM) according to preliminary results won the parliamentary elections in Moldova. She won 23 percent. votes. Igor Dodon leader of the party in favor of canceling the summer of Moldova signed an association agreement with the EU.

Also, the pro-Russian Party of Communists of the Republic of Moldova has gained 20 percent. votes. Parties in favor of closer ties with the European Union, which held the power in Moldova since 2009., The Liberal Democratic Party of Moldova (PDLM) and the Democratic Party of Moldova (PDM) previously received 17 and 16 percent. votes – said chairman of the Central Electoral Commission, Iurie Ciocan.
elections were observed with great interest in Europe since held at a time when the conflict continues in neighboring Ukraine. After the annexation of the Crimea by Russia, many observers believed that scenario could be repeated in the separatist and Russian-speaking population inhabited by Moldavian Transnistria.

Leader PSRM against the Association Agreement with the EU

PSRM, whose leader Igor Dodon recently met with Russian President Vladimir Putin, in favor of canceling the summer of Moldova signed an association agreement with the EU.

– organize a referendum; people alone should decide whether to integrate with the EU or with the Customs Union with Russia – said recently. According to opinion polls 40 percent of Moldovans favor of integration with the EU and the same support to the country to join the Customs Union formed by Russia, Belarus and Kazakhstan.

Moldova torn between the EU and Moscow

Associated Press points out that inhabited by nearly 4 million people Moldova torn between the choice of the continuation of the current pro-European course and closer ties with Moscow. Moscow imposed an embargo on Moldovan fruit after this poor post-Soviet republic in June signed an association agreement with the EU.

It is estimated that more than 600 thousand. Moldovans working abroad, half in the EU and the road half in Russia. Sent out their money are approx. 1/5 of Moldovan GDP.

Foreign Minister Frank-Walter Steinmeier in an interview with ZDF warned Ukraine against efforts to join the NATO, because it would be “topping fuel to the fire.” Berlin is set at a long-standing conflict with Russia over Ukraine.
 

Frank-Walter Steinmeier told ZDF that he understood because of the situation of the Ukrainians desire to achieve military and political support from the Alliance. – But we have to be realistic. We’re in the middle of a dangerous conflict. We are witnessing the terrible events – explained the head of German diplomacy.
 

He stressed that it is possible to imagine a further deterioration of the situation in Ukraine. Therefore, due to a sense of responsibility, you should tell the public that “Do not add fuel to the fire.”
 


 - Inputs Ukraine into NATO in my opinion, can not be put on the agenda. Anyway, I do not see Ukraine in NATO – Steinmeier said. He added that there is a “total clarity on this issue,” and skip some aspects is not helpful. – Other formulate public speaking can be thought more carefully, but I know that many just like to see the problem – Steinmeier said in an interview with ZDF.
 

According to Steinmeier conflict with Russia Ukraine may last for a decade, and perhaps longer. – The conflict can be called in 14 days, the solution may take up to 14 years – noted the Minister. In his opinion, the dispute with Russia Ukraine is a “serious”, because – as he said – “do not believe in finding a quick solution.”
 

The head of German diplomacy considered unsolvable problem of Crimea. – Legal recognition of the fact of annexation is not out of the question. You can not afford to ignore, forget, or simply move the agenda of the international illegal annexation of Crimea – German politician noted.
 

Steinmerer confirmed the readiness of Germany to negotiate with Moscow in order to find a political solution to the conflict.
 

Ukraine after the recent parliamentary elections, announced his resignation from the status of a country outside military alliances. President of Ukraine Petro Poroshenko said that Ukraine should give up its status as a country outside military blocs, but there is no question that his country has become in a short time a member of NATO.

The symbolic significance of the wreck

Pełczyńska-adviser said that “Polish society of great symbolic importance that the plane where the tragedy took place, returned to Polish”. Polish ambassador stated that “it is one of the problems that no matter must be resolved quickly because it has a negative impact on the perception of Russia by the Polish people.”



The wreck at the disposal of the Investigative Committee FR

The wreckage of Tu-154M is still at the airport in Smolensk. The Russian side considers the wreck an aircraft and its on-board recorders as evidence that it needs until the end of the investigation. Consistently held that until then they will remain at the disposal of the Investigative Committee of the Russian Federation.

on 10 April 2010 in the chair. 8.41 at Smolensk plane crashed Tu-154M, the Polish state delegation flew to Katyn to commemorate the 70th anniversary of the NKVD massacre of Polish officers.

The crash killed 96 people, including Polish President Lech Kaczynski and his wife Maria. Along with the presidential couple also suffered the death of ministers, parliamentarians, heads of central government agencies, the commander of the armed forces of all kinds, as well as officers of the Government Protection Bureau and the Tupolev crew members.

Darren Wilson in August killed a black teenager Michael Brown in Ferguson, Missouri. 18-year-old’s death triggered a wave of riots. The policeman decided to resign from the service.

The information offered on Saturday, 28-year-old lawyer Darren Wilson Neil Bruntrager. A police officer has so far been on vacation. Resignation he has made, shall come into force with immediate effect – the lawyer said.

Sam Wilson told the newspaper, “St. Louis Post-Dispatch” that departs from the service of their own accord. He explained that the local police department received a warning against the threat of continued employment. – I do not want anyone else been hurt because of me – he said.

The death of a teenager local community considered it a racially motivated crime. Started violent protests, which quickly escalated into rioting, arson and looting shops. November 25 the jury found that there was no reason to Wilson stood trial for murder. After this decision, there was another wave of riots. Protests also erupted among in Boston, New York, Los Angeles, Dallas and Atlanta.

Police with Ferguson, a town inhabited mainly by African Americans, claimed after Brown’s death that the teenager behaved aggressively. In contrast, the witnesses claimed that Wilson shot at unarmed Brown, although this was with hands up.

accused of pedophilia

In October this year. Warsaw District Prosecutor’s Office sent the court indictment against Father Wojciech G., which accused him of 10 crimes, including – sexual intercourse with a minor and harassment. Wronged by the prosecutor’s office found 8 persons: 2 and 6 of Polish citizens Dominican citizens. The findings of the investigation indicate that the two acts Father. G. committed in 2000-2001 in Poland, and the other – in the years 2009-2013 in the Dominican Republic.

In addition to the possession of the prosecution accused the priest in the Dominican Republic pornographic content involving minors under 15 years of age and having no permit gun and ammunition. He alleged acts are punishable up to 12 years in prison, but in case of conviction for two or more offenses the court will be able to impose his total penalty for up to 15 years.

The priest pleaded not guilty to the charges and exercised the right to refuse to answer questions. February 19th is in custody.

As said the head of the parliamentary committee. penitentiary William Ojeda, up to 35 people has increased the number of casualties among the prisoners, who on Wednesday deliberately overdosed on drugs. 20 people are in a coma.

The incident took place in a prison in Uribe, in northwestern Venezuela. From Wednesday last hunger strike there against conditions in prison – it was mainly about ill-treatment and human rights violations by security guards.

145 prisoners managed to get to Wednesday przywięziennego hospital where many of them have used significant amounts of antiepileptic drugs and hypertension, while consuming alcohol. A total of 35 people died, while 20 more are in a coma.

According to the report, the organization Venezuelan Observatory of Prisons in Venezuela’s prisons are critically overcrowded – 20 thousand. places is more than 55 thousand. people. In prisons, its very poor sanitation, and rampant violence in them, which resulted in only in the first quarter of 2014. More than 150 prisoners were killed.

The number of victims in an attack in Nigeria. According to agency reports, in the morgue of the local hospital in Kano body are at least 92 victims of the bomb. More than 130 people were injured. Unknown data from the other two medical clinics.
The assassination took place before the Great Mosque in the old town the largest city in the north of the country, Kano. This area of ​​Nigeria is plagued by Muslim terrorists with Boko Haram. It is they who are suspected of organizing the assassination.

In the past days in Nigeria, there also were other violent acts. Yesterday, at least 40 people were killed in a bomb explosion at a busy intersection in the north-eastern part of the country. In turn, on Tuesday in a suicide bombing in which two women detonated in a crowded marketplace explosives, killing nearly 50 people.

The Channel influenced the Russian Northern Fleet warships. Units shall carry out the exercise.

The decision to carry out exercises in the English Channel handed command of the Russian army. Today we received there and auxiliary warships, including landing craft, tug, tanker and the main unit – the destroyer “Sewieromorsk”, which was built in the 80s and is designed to fight other ships.

The Russian ships sailed today by the narrowest part of the channel between Britain and France. As a result of the storm, the unit had to stop at neutral waters to him to wait. At this time exercise was conducted. Ultimately, the ships sail the Atlantic, where they will take part in military maneuvers.

Units of the Northern Fleet base in Murmansk left on 20 November.
